Transcripts encoding molecules that can antagonize the effects of BMP-2 and BMP-4 are present in the fetal bowel. RT-PCR was used to detect transcripts encoding gremlin, noggin, chordin, and follistatin in RNA extracted from the whole gut (Gut) and from separated populations of crest-derived (CD) and noncrest-derived (non-CD) cells. A, Transcripts encoding gremlin and noggin were observed to be present in the whole fetal bowel as early as E12. They were also detected in the brain (Br), which was investigated as a positive control. No PCR products were obtained when reverse transcriptase was omitted (NoRT). B, Transcripts encoding noggin were detected in both the crest-derived and noncrest-derived populations of cells. C, Transcripts encoding chordin and follist at in were detected in the whole fetal bowel as early as E12. Expression of β-actin(A, C) was investigated to semiquantitatively normalize RNA. ad, Adult.
